At the start of Christmas break, a few of our high school students that participated in the “Sweat for a Vet” challenge had the opportunity to meet with Sgt. Massey of the United States Army, and give him the gifts for the holiday care packages. He informed us that part of the gifts would be taken to Fort Campbell and Fort Leonard Wood for soldiers remaining on base during the holidays. The remaining gifts would be taken to the USO at Lambert Airport in St. Louis for soldiers leaving for deployment during the holidays. We are extremely proud of each student that stepped up and participated in this challenge. Thank you again to all those that donated. ❤️🤍💙 #SCPride

Scott City High School students, Luke Holder, Avarie O'brien, Shelby Stroup, and Olivia Ponder came together to create the "Christmas Angels" project. Their mission was to provide holiday hope and love by becoming the Angels of Christmas. This program was an effort to provide support to local families this Christmas season. These students raised $700 dollars to purchase Christmas gifts for 7 Scott City School students. We are extremely proud of these students for illustrating kindness, compassion, and love for others.
